Wike’s aide blasts Amaechi for complaining after spending 23 years in govt


Senior Special Assistant on Public Communications and Social Media to the Minister of the Federal Capital Territory, FCT, Nyesom Wike, Lere Olayinka, has berated former Minister of Transportation, Rotimi Amaechi, over his latest outbursts against the Nigerian government.
Olayinka said Amaechi should hide his face in shame for complaining after spending 23 years in government.
Writing on X, Wife’s aide recollected the number of years Amaechi has spent in government.
He wrote: “After spending 23 years in government, Rotimi Amaechi is still blaming the government.
“8 years as Speaker, 8 years as governor, and 7 years as Minister.
“Some people sha no get shame.
“Since 1999, Rotimi Amaechi has only been out of Govt for just TWO YEARS.
“Rotimi Amaechi said he is hungry, and you are supporting him because you don’t like those in govt now.”
The comment of Wike’s assistant comes after Amaechi said that he and majority of Nigerians are hungry.
Speaking during the celebration of his 60th birthday in Abuja, Amaechi stated that the opposition coalition has the capacity to unseat President Bola Tinubu from power.
Amaechi added that Nigerian politicians quarrel over sharing of the nation’s resources.
He said there are no ideas among Nigerian politicians, which leads to the fight over sharing of resources.
